H&S Trainer at Veolia ES UK Limited
Cannock WS11 8JP, , United Kingdom -
Full Time


Start Date

Immediate

Expiry Date

08 Nov, 25

Salary

0.0

Posted On

08 Aug, 25

Experience

0 year(s) or above

Remote Job

Yes

Telecommute

Yes

Sponsor Visa

No

Skills

Good communication skills

Industry

Information Technology/IT

Description

Ready to find the right role for you?
Competitive Salary plus Car/Allowance, bonus
Location: Cannock with UK travel
When you see the world as we do, you see the chance to help the world take better care of its resources, and help it become a better place for everyone. It’s why we’re looking for someone who’s just as committed as we are, to push for genuine change and bring our ambition of Ecological Transformation to life. We know that everyone here at Veolia can help us work alongside our communities, look after the environment, and contribute to our inclusive culture.

How To Apply:

Incase you would like to apply to this job directly from the source, please click here

Responsibilities
  • Design, deliver and evaluate engaging and effective classroom/group based sessions and remote and virtual learning through digital platforms; utilising a variety of blended and inspiring teaching and learning strategies.
  • Regularly design and adapt course content to match business needs, working alongside subject matter experts in the operation to ensure it is relevant and up to date with legislation and Veolia policy and procedure.
  • Deliver a variety of ‘Veolia specific’ Safety, Health & Environmental courses to embed Veolia’s safety culture.
  • Internally train and verify our site assessors who deliver role specific training in line with Veolia Minimum Requirements.
  • Develop an understanding of how our people operate (behavioural) and embed this into training sessions/content that is reflective of our business.
  • Ensure the logistics and administration that underpin the delivery schedule are completed within a timely manner.
  • Generate business reports outlining key activities undertaken including financial and delegate data.
  • Utilise the latest and emerging digital and mobile technologies to increase the digital literacy of our people.
  • To continually update your own knowledge and skills as a professional development practitioner and SHE subject specialist.
  • Working in collaboration with the wider Risk and Assurance team, develop and maintain behavioural safety resources creating an active risk culture at all levels of the business.
  • Work in collaboration with the wider Risk & Assurance team at a local level to effectively diagnose learning needs in relation to health and safety knowledge, skills and behaviours.
  • Work in collaboration with the wider Risk & Assurance team at a local level to analyse data and findings in order to shape course design and delivery.
  • To work with internal and external stakeholders and coordinate learning outcomes to culminate in the successful achievement of all our programmes.
  • To work with other internal training colleagues to effectively market and communicate opportunities with our stakeholders.
  • Actively seek feedback from a variety of stakeholders/customers to support quality improvements in diagnostic, design and delivery of content.
  • Create clear success measures when designing content where ROI is at the forefront of all our training solutions.
Loading...